What Makes an Effective Senior Living Website?

1. User-Friendly Navigation

Families and potential residents may be familiar with technology at varying levels. A clear, user-friendly layout is essential to ensuring that visitors find relevant information about care options, pricing, and amenities quickly. Ensuring the website is mobile-optimized is equally important, as mobile search is increasingly common among all age groups. By providing simple and accessible navigation, visitors are more likely to stay engaged.

2. High-Quality Virtual Tours and Image Galleries

Showcasing the facility through virtual tours and image galleries is a powerful way to draw visitors in. These features offer potential residents a real feel for the environment, giving them a better sense of the spaces they may live in. High-quality visuals often create a stronger connection and can significantly increase the likelihood of inquiries or tours. This feature is especially beneficial for distant families who cannot visit in person right away.

3. Engaging and Informative Content

A senior living website needs to answer the big questions families and potential residents have—like details on services, care plans, dining, and activities. The content should be easy to read and clear and highlight what makes your community unique, with a focus on personalized care and the lifestyle you offer. Adding testimonials from residents and their families can help build trust and credibility. Showcasing your staff’s qualifications and the specific care you provide can also set your community apart.

It’s all about providing helpful information that reassures visitors while giving them a sense of what life in your community is really like.

4. Interactive Tools for User Engagement

Interactive features, like cost calculators or quizzes, let users explore options based on what’s important to them. These tools can draw in potential residents or their families, helping them get more involved with your site and increasing the chance they’ll reach out for more info. Personalized, interactive experiences can help your community stand out.

5. Security and Privacy Matter

Senior living websites often handle sensitive information, such as health or financial inquiries. Ensuring your site is secure with encrypted forms and following privacy regulations is vital to building trust with families. They need to know that their details are safe and protected.
